Map: The Young Ladies of America Can't ALL Be California Girls
The Beach Boys will be reuniting onstage at the 54th Grammy Awards this Sunday, which makes now as good a time as any to have a chuckle at this map of the United States that breaks down young ladies by description and region.
Yesterday brought the announcement that the band--Brian Wilson, Mike Love, Al Jardine, Bruce Johnston and David Marks--will be together for the first time in more than twenty years to perform at the annual recording industry award shindig, which is taking place at The Staples Center.
Of course, Brian Wilson and the Beach Boys wish they could all be California girls. A past Grammy performer, Katy Perry, just might agree...
